Roll Call

Roll Call identifies over 7,000 men, women and children who were interned in Canada during World War I. The information was drawn from a broad network of internment camps, and reveals diverse ethnicities, corresponding P.O.W. numbers, detailed vital statistics, release or deportation dates, physical descriptions, and other important historical data. This data will be updated as additional information becomes available.
